Pullet – A young chicken normally less than 1 year old.  Pullets can be purchased as young as 15 weeks and can begin to lay eggs as early as 24 weeks.  Many pullets are purchased during the Easter holiday season as cute pets.  They soon find themselves headed for a new home.
